Paal Enger, the Norwegian man who stole Edvard Munch’s iconic painting ‘The Scream’ in 1994, has passed away at the age of 57. Enger and his accomplices took the painting from the National Gallery in Oslo, but it was recovered shortly after. Despite the crime, Enger maintained that he was an art lover and claimed he did it to draw attention to the lack of security in museums.
